## Deploying TrailGlass

Quick notes for the weekly sync: TrailGlass (our audit-log viewer) now ships as a single container, so the old two-step deploy is gone. Push to main, wait for the Harborline pipeline to go green, then promote. Rollbacks take about ninety seconds. One gotcha — the viewer won't start without its retention and index settings, so double-check them before promoting. Here's what the current production deploy is running with.

settings of tagef-bawif:
DRUIX_HOST=druix.zemvarlabs.internal
DRUIX_PORT=8000

**Release checklist — Shrinkray CLI v2.4**

Welcome aboard! Before we tag, please run the batch-resize smoke test: point Shrinkray at the sample folder of 200 mixed-format images, confirm it honors the --max-width flag, and check that EXIF orientation survives. Don't worry about the WebP warnings, those are known and harmless. Once the run finishes clean, note the elapsed time in the checklist doc. The candidate build to test against is below.

build token for bajog-yaduf: htk9_39788324c

## Partner SFTP Drop — Brightmere Feed

Files land hourly from Brightmere's SFTP into the `inbound-raw` bucket via the Ferrymast poller. Reviewer: confirm the poller retries on partial transfers and rejects files without a `.done` marker. Checksums are validated before handoff to the Quillbatch ingest service. If ingest stalls, check Ferrymast logs first, then requeue manually. The poller authenticates to Quillbatch over the internal mesh. Use the key below for manual requeue calls.

API key for tagef-fafop: vxb2-ta

**Mgmt Meeting Minutes — Retiring the Brightline Range**

Quick recap for sales leads at Fenholt Supplies: we agreed to retire the Brightline fixture range by year-end. Remaining stock moves to clearance pricing next month, and accounts on standing orders get migrated to the Lumetta range. Trade-in incentives were approved in principle. The confidential note on next steps sits just below.

board note of bajof-bajeg: The pricing group signed off on a budget of $13.4 million for Project Sildor. The renewal with Lamixek Holdings closes at $48.9 million a year, 49 percent above the last contract.